Ambriola Co., Inc. recalled 45 bags of Pinna Grated Pecorino Romano on November 21, 2025, after Listeria Monocytogenes was detected. The recall affects products distributed in 17 states including California and Texas. Consumers should not consume the recalled product and should seek refunds or replacements.
Product tested positive for Listeria Monocytogenes.

The recall involves 10-pound plastic bags of Pinna Grated Pecorino Romano, lot number 1000572486. The product was distributed across states including Arizona, California, and New York. No specific price was mentioned.
The recalled cheese tested positive for Listeria Monocytogenes, a harmful bacterium that can cause serious infections. This poses a significant health risk, especially for pregnant women, newborns, elderly, and individuals with weakened immune systems.
No injuries or illnesses have been reported in connection with this product as of the latest report. However, Listeria can lead to severe health complications.
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led product. Contact Ambriola Co., Inc. for refund or replacement information via email or telephone.
